Salaries for mental health professionals in Miami have increased. In 2010 mental health professionals in Miami reportedly earned an average salary of $34,888 per year. The average salary for mental health professionals in Miami was $33,002 per year, four years earlier in 2006. This growth is slower than the salary trend for all careers in Miami.

Miami mental health professionals earn a median yearly salary of $35,228. The difference in pay between the mental health professionals in the lowest pay bracket and those in the highest pay bracket is approximately 118%. Those in the lowest 10% of the pay bracket earn less than $22,378 per year, while those in the highest 10% of the pay bracket earn more than $48,814 per year.
